summaryrefslogtreecommitdiffstats
path: root/generic/tclFCmd.c
diff options
context:
space:
mode:
authorjan.nijtmans <jan.nijtmans@noemail.net>2012-03-27 12:15:14 (GMT)
committerjan.nijtmans <jan.nijtmans@noemail.net>2012-03-27 12:15:14 (GMT)
commit56e6f7e3481611e85613edd7d4bb51fb3d795164 (patch)
tree0a70e88fac3b104e6ff95b5b7b11a41872249aea /generic/tclFCmd.c
parentceebe9160bd5204d1437f2d235b30a3ea07f8c11 (diff)
parentf21b67e800cc27d792703d210f590e3104030468 (diff)
downloadtcl-56e6f7e3481611e85613edd7d4bb51fb3d795164.zip
tcl-56e6f7e3481611e85613edd7d4bb51fb3d795164.tar.gz
tcl-56e6f7e3481611e85613edd7d4bb51fb3d795164.tar.bz2
[Bug 3508771] Wrong Tcl_StatBuf used on MinGW
[Bug 2015723] duplicate inodes from file stat on windows (but now for cygwin as well) FossilOrigin-Name: cd7415d81d850238c4927b95b33bae8fd3ed6844
Diffstat (limited to 'generic/tclFCmd.c')
-rw-r--r--generic/tclFCmd.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/generic/tclFCmd.c b/generic/tclFCmd.c
index e95a136..a868fe3 100644
--- a/generic/tclFCmd.c
+++ b/generic/tclFCmd.c
@@ -520,7 +520,7 @@ CopyRenameOneFile(
* 16 bits and we get collisions. See bug #2015723.
*/
-#ifndef WIN32
+#if !defined(WIN32) && !defined(__CYGWIN__)
if ((sourceStatBuf.st_ino != 0) && (targetStatBuf.st_ino != 0)) {
if ((sourceStatBuf.st_ino == targetStatBuf.st_ino) &&
(sourceStatBuf.st_dev == targetStatBuf.st_dev)) {